That is true, the one in the US is the SCH-i700, which is CDMA based, and it is triband, but not the triband you think of. It is 800-MHz Analog, 800 MHZ CDMA, and 1900 MHZ CDMA. Nothing in common :wink:
A GSM version is coming up, it is called the SGH-i700. It is identical to the CDMA version except for the radio, and for the download speed (CDMA is faster)
The issue is, with GSM handsets, they must go into retail via carriers, and that sometimes make the device unavailable in the market for many months after being released by manufacturers. But with esatblished handset ODMs, many retails take the chance on them and buy directly from manufacturers, as it is the case with Nokia and Ericsson.
Given that sasung is aslo an established ODM, I do think availabilty outside carrier's offering won't be an issue, and it won't be late either.

people seem confused about 'grey' imports and 'asian' phones
ALL diamonds, every single one that we have in our hands, were made in asia, apparently taiwan. they have exactly the same hardware. they are the same phone. The so called 'UK spec' models are exactly the same, with a different ROM. The only advantage of 'UK spec' is probable better local HTC support but even that is debatable. Maybe in the future when HTC do a 2nd production run there will be difference in hardware, but there isn't any now.
HTC distribute these identical devices with different ROMs according to their intended export destination. observed differences in performance come from the different ROMS, occasionally useful tweaks, and the almost superstitious and fanatical obsession many of us seem to have with 'tweaking' our devices' (if you change registry key HKLM/Drivers/Biotouch/SecretPerformanceBoost/Enable to 1 and soft reset, the device is much faster and TF3D more responsive).. I mean we're all geeks or we wouldn't be here but lets try a little perspective. Many of these tweaks don't do anything but give us a comforting dose of placebo effect..

If you buy a UK phone from a carrier (like O2, Vodafone, Orange, T-Mobile, etc.) they will be locked as they are often subsidised by the carrier, although the carrier sometimes unlocks them for no charge if you ask.
In terms of logo use, O2 doesn't seem to brand any of their phones on the outer hardware, they just brand the software. But they seem to be the only one - Vodafone, Orange and T-Mobile over here seem to brand a lot of their phones on the case.
